Given :

A circle is inscribed in a square with a side length of 144.

So, radius of circle, r = 144/2 = 72 units.

To Find :

The probability that the point is inside the circle.

Solution :

Area of circle,

A_c = \pi r^2\\\\A_c = 3.14 \times 72^2\ units^2\\\\A_c = 16277.76 \ units^2

Area of square,

A_s = (2r)^2\\\\A_s = ( 2 \times 72)^2\ units^2\\\\A_s = 20736\ units^2

Now, probability is given by :

P = \dfrac{A_c}{A_s}\\\\P = \dfrac{16277.76}{20736}\\\\P = 0.785

Therefore, the probability that the point is inside the circle is 0.785 .

One large bubble separates into four small bubbles so that the total area of the small bubbles is equal to the area of the large
sergey [27]

Answer:

R = 10 cm

Step-by-step explanation:

The area of a spherical shape is given by :

A=4\pi r^2

Where

r is the radius of the sphere

ATQ,

One large bubble separates into four small bubbles so that the total area of the small bubbles is equal to the area of the large bubble.

The radius of each small bubble is 5 cm

Using the given condition,

4\pi R^2=4\times (4\pi r^2)\\\\R^2=4r^2\\\\R=\sqrt{4r^2} \\\\R=2r\\\\R=2\times 5\\\\R=10\ cm

So, the radius of the large bubble is equal to 10 cm.
